Layout funding is a type of short-term lending that is paid off in 30 to 90 days, the moment it typically takes to market an auto. A regular new vehicle sets you back a dealership regarding $5 to $10 in passion daily. If a cars and truck sits on the whole lot for 30 days, the dealership will certainly be charged $150 - $300 in passion repayments - ron marhofer nissan.


The majority of producers compensate these financing costs with what is called "". This is usually 2 - 3% of the billing price of the automobile. On a typical $28,000 cars and truck, a 2% holdback would amount to around $550. If the supplier sells this cars and truck in thirty days and sustains funding costs of $300, then they will certainly make a profit of $250 on the holdback.

, automobile dealerships have actually traditionally been an important source of state and neighborhood sales taxes. By 2010, all US states had laws that restricted suppliers from side-stepping independent auto dealerships and marketing autos directly to consumers.


Economic experts have actually identified these guidelines as a type of rent-seeking that essences rental fees from producers of automobiles, raises costs for consumers, and limits entry of brand-new vehicle dealers while raising profits for incumbent cars and truck dealerships. ron marhofer. Research study shows that as an outcome of these laws, list prices for vehicles are greater than they otherwise would be


Today, direct sales by an automaker to consumers are limited by many states in the united state via franchise laws that need brand-new autos to be sold only by accredited and bonded, separately had car dealerships. The first woman automobile supplier in the USA was Rachel "Mom" Krouse who in 1903 opened her organization, Krouse Electric motor Cars And Truck Business, in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ania.

Audi has try out a hi-tech showroom that allows customers to set up and experience automobiles on 1:1 scale electronic screens. In markets where it is permitted, Mercedes-Benz opened city centre brand stores. Tesla Motors has actually declined the car dealership sales design based upon the idea that dealerships do not appropriately clarify the benefits of their vehicles, and they could not rely upon third-party dealers to handle their sales.


In feedback, Tesla has actually opened up city centre galleries where possible customers can see autos that can only be bought online. These stores were inspired by the Apple Shops. Tesla's design was the very first of its kind, and has offered them distinct advantages as a brand-new automobile business. ron marhoffer nissan. In economic concept, cars and truck dealers can be identified as franchisees and car makers as franchisors.

The franchisor can act opportunistically by enforcing restraints and burden on the franchisee after the latter has actually sustained sunk prices, such as purchasing physical assets and constructing up a credibility with customers. The franchisor could as an example need that cars and trucks be cost low cost, and services be performed for little settlement.


Automobile dealerships have lobbied for guidelines that increase the survival and earnings of car dealerships: By 2010, all US states had laws that prohibited manufacturers from side-stepping independent cars and truck dealers and selling vehicles to consumers straight. By 2009, the majority of states enforced restrictions on the development of brand-new car dealerships to take on incumbent car dealerships.

Many states prevent producers from participating in "amount requiring" whereby suppliers require that suppliers acquisition vehicles that they had not gotten. The majority our website of states limit the capability of suppliers to differentiate in between vehicle dealerships (as an example, by giving much better terms to large automobile dealers with economic climates of scale or suppliers that give far better customer solution).


The majority of state regulations call for upon the discontinuation of a car dealership that manufacturers purchase back the stock, and special tools and sometimes pay the rental fee of the dealership's facilities. The issuance of new dealership licenses can be subject to geographical limitation; if there is already a dealer for a firm in an area, no person else can open up one.

Financial experts have characterized these legislations as a type of rent-seeking that extracts rents from producers of autos and increases costs for consumers of vehicles while elevating earnings for automobile suppliers. Several research studies have revealed that regulations that protect auto dealers increase auto prices for consumers and limit the success of producers.
